Compartilhar via


BlobBeginCopyFromUrlPollState interface

O estado usado pelo sondador retornado de beginCopyFromURL.

Esse estado é passado para o retorno de chamada especificado pelo onProgress usuário sempre que o progresso da cópia é detectado.

Extends

Propriedades

blobClient

A instância de BlobClient que foi usada ao chamar beginCopyFromURL.

copyId

A copyId que identifica a cópia de blob em andamento.

copyProgress

o progresso da cópia de blob conforme relatado pelo serviço.

copySource

A URL de origem fornecida em beginCopyFromURL.

startCopyFromURLOptions

As opções que foram passadas para a chamada inicial beginCopyFromURL . Isso é exposto para o sondador e não deve ser modificado diretamente.

Propriedades herdadas

error

Existirá se a operação tiver encontrado algum erro.

isCancelled

True se a operação tiver sido cancelada.

isCompleted

True se a operação tiver sido concluída.

isStarted

True se a operação tiver sido iniciada.

result

Existirá se a operação for concluída em um resultado de um tipo esperado.

Detalhes da propriedade

blobClient

A instância de BlobClient que foi usada ao chamar beginCopyFromURL.

blobClient: CopyPollerBlobClient

Valor da propriedade

copyId

A copyId que identifica a cópia de blob em andamento.

copyId?: string

Valor da propriedade

string

copyProgress

o progresso da cópia de blob conforme relatado pelo serviço.

copyProgress?: string

Valor da propriedade

string

copySource

A URL de origem fornecida em beginCopyFromURL.

copySource: string

Valor da propriedade

string

startCopyFromURLOptions

As opções que foram passadas para a chamada inicial beginCopyFromURL . Isso é exposto para o sondador e não deve ser modificado diretamente.

startCopyFromURLOptions?: BlobStartCopyFromURLOptions

Valor da propriedade

Detalhes das propriedades herdadas

error

Existirá se a operação tiver encontrado algum erro.

error?: Error

Valor da propriedade

Error

Herdado dePollOperationState.error

isCancelled

True se a operação tiver sido cancelada.

isCancelled?: boolean

Valor da propriedade

boolean

Herdado dePollOperationState.isCancelled

isCompleted

True se a operação tiver sido concluída.

isCompleted?: boolean

Valor da propriedade

boolean

Herdado dePollOperationState.isCompleted

isStarted

True se a operação tiver sido iniciada.

isStarted?: boolean

Valor da propriedade

boolean

Herdado dePollOperationState.isStarted

result

Existirá se a operação for concluída em um resultado de um tipo esperado.

result?: BlobBeginCopyFromURLResponse

Valor da propriedade

Herdado dePollOperationState.result